What the role is

The HR Specialist plays a key role in Strategic Workforce Planning, HR Process Re-engineering and drive HR data model development. This position will also lead cross-functional teams to manage data analytics and insights for informed decision-making, and partners with business units to identify and manage the impact of workforce risks to their department/division and ACRA.

What you will be working on

• Manage a wide spectrum of HR functions, which may include HR business partnering, strategic manpower planning and recruitment, HR Process Re-engineering (includes recruitment and employee engagement processes), HR data analytics and insights, learning and development, employee engagement, talent management, performance management, compensation and benefits and exit management. • Develop and implement HR policies and frameworks to ensure that market competitiveness and alignment with ACRA’s corporate goals. • Work closely with all levels of stakeholders to co-develop solutions to provide seamless positive work experience, enhance staff morale and retention. • Lead/participate actively in projects or other initiatives as assigned.

What we are looking for

Key Competencies • Strategic Workforce Planning - Ability to align HR strategies and policies by determining and developing the workforce capacity and capability, in order to achieve organisation goals, now and into the future. • Process Management: Ability to understand how different systems, processes and people interact and influence one another and analyse processes using tools and methodologies to enhance HR operations and transactions. • Analytics - Ability to use data and analytics across a range of HR functions to generate insights for business intelligence and foresights for planning purposes. • Tech & Digital Adopter - Ability to leverage technology and digital tools as core enablers to optimise and enhance HR functions, in order to create a high-performing organisation. • Communications & Relationship Management – Ability to foster strong relationships with stakeholders, communicate effectively, and build trust, so as to effectively influence, facilitate, negotiate and resolve conflict in order to develop and engage employees. Job Requirements • 6 years in HR experience preferably in Strategic Workforce Planning, HR business partnering and/or policy writing. • Able to work in a fast-paced environment and is versatile. • Positive attitude, good team player and has a strong sense of commitment to contribute to Public Service • Possess strong interpersonal, written and verbal communication skills
